Convert Gigavolt to Picovolt
Unit definitions
Gigavolt
$10^{9} \ \text{V}$ is a gigavolt.
Picovolt
$\frac{1}{10^{12}} \ \text{V}$ is a picovolt.
How to convert Gigavolt to Picovolt
$$\text{Electric Potential}_{\text{pV}} = \text{Electric Potential}_{\text{GV}} \cdot {10}^{21}$$
